Transaction 23990c72128a1a0f88abd68123b940259f813ff4ddef093a53687061be2ebf76
1 Input
1 Output
-
23990c72128a1a0f88abd68123b940259f813ff4ddef093a53687061be2ebf76:0
- value
- 150897
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 25037a531ed04e8dc6b3dc7ecc23b4b82f866446 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14NiAk1uDZWZs4BDe2FGrodvjbLwz1w2Qq